Maternity, childcare leaves for women soldiers

NEW DELHI: Defence Minister Rajnath Singh approved a proposal for extension of the rules for maternity, child care and child adoption leaves for women soldiers, sailors and air warriors in the Armed Forces at par with their officer counterparts. With the issuing of the rules, the grant of such leaves to all women in the military, whether one is an officer or any other rank, will be equally applicable.

The decision is in line with the government’s vision of inclusive participation of all women in the Armed Forces, irrespective of their ranks. The extension of leave rules will go a long way in dealing with women-specific family and social issues relevant to the Armed Forces.

This measure is going to improve the work conditions of women in the military and aid them to balance the spheres of professional and family life in a better manner.

Furthering PM Modi-led Government’s commitment towards utilising Nari Shakti, the three services have spearheaded a paradigm shift with inclusion of women as soldiers, sailors and air warriors.

With the recruitment of women Agniveers, the Armed Forces will be empowered with the bravery, dedication and patriotism of women soldiers, sailors and air warriors to defend the land, sea and air frontiers of the country.
